One number is three more than twice a second number. Their product is 119. Find the numbers.

The numbers are 7 and 17


twice of 7 is 14 and 3 + 14 = 17

construct a 90% confidence interval of the population proportion using the giver information x=74 n=150

Answer:

The 90% confidence interval of the population proportion is (0.43, 0.56).

Step-by-step explanation:

The (1 - <em>α</em>)% confidence interval for population proportion <em>p</em> is:

CI=\hat p\pm z_{\alpha/2}\ \sqrt{\frac{\hat p(1-\hat p)}{n}}

The information provided is:

<em>X</em> = 74

<em>n</em> = 150

Confidence level = 90%

Compute the value of sample proportion as follows:

\hat p=\frac{X}{n}=\frac{74}{150}=0.493

Compute the critical value of <em>z</em> for 90% confidence level as follows:

z_{\alpha/2}=z_{0.10/2}=z_{0.05}=1.645

*Use a <em>z</em>-table.

Compute the 90% confidence interval of the population proportion as follows:

CI=\hat p\pm z_{\alpha/2}\ \sqrt{\frac{\hat p(1-\hat p)}{n}}

     =0.493\pm 1.645\times \sqrt{\frac{0.493(1-0.493)}{150}}\\\\=0.493\pm 0.0672\\\\=(0.4258,\ 0.5602)\\\\\approx (0.43,\ 0.56)

Thus, the 90% confidence interval of the population proportion is (0.43, 0.56).
